Imaginative Role-play

In continuous provision there is the opportunity both inside and outside to participate in deconstructed role-play.  This activity allows the children to engage in the role play experience with no limitations on their imaginations.

The children decided to transform the cardboard boxes into a fort and to draw features.

The cardboard boxes were pretend cat baskets

Using the wooden building blocks, the children worked together to construct a car.
